Driver training schools are licensed by DMV to offer driver education programs statewide to residents of all ages. The program includes 36 classroom sessions, seven driving sessions, seven observation sessions and a final road skills examination. Each session is 50-minutes long.
The Application Process. There are two steps to applying for your learner’s permit: 1) Submitting the proper documents and fees, and 2) Taking the relevant tests. Both steps can be done in person at any DMV customer service center. Schedule an Appointment Online.

Virginia's Mileage Choice Program is a voluntary option for drivers of eligible vehicles to pay their highway use fee on a per-mile basis instead of an annual highway use fee at the time of registration renewal. You only pay for the miles you drive, so if you drive less, you pay less.
